Punjab Chief Minister Bhagwant Mann announced that all Sikh MLAs and cabinet ministers will appear before the Akal Takht on June 29 regarding the anti-sacrilege law. This decision follows a closed-door meeting in Amritsar, where Mann stated that representatives would present their views in writing. The Akal Takht had summoned Sikh legislators and ministers over objections to the Jaagat Jot Sri Guru Granth Sahib Satkar (Amendment) Act, 2026, which it claims was enacted without consulting the Sikh Panth. Mann also addressed accusations of challenging the Akal Takht's authority and criticised political appointees for one-sided decisions.

The Supreme Court, using its extraordinary powers under Article 142, has quashed the conviction of a man sentenced under the POCSO Act. This decision came after the victim, who was a minor at the time of the offence, married the accused upon reaching adulthood. The court emphasised that this ruling is based on the peculiar facts of the case and should not be considered a precedent.

Former Wimbledon champion Marketa Vondrousova has been banned for four years after missing a doping test, leading the Professional Tennis Players Association (PTPA) to demand a greater say for athletes in anti-doping regulations. Vondrousova cited safety concerns for not opening her door to a doping control officer late at night, while the International Tennis Integrity Agency (ITIA) maintains that unpredictable testing is crucial for clean sport.
